Required setup
CometChatUIKit.init(UIKitSettings) then CometChatUIKit.login("UID") — must complete before rendering any component

At the heart of CometChat’s functionality is the ability to support real-time text messaging. Users can send and receive instant messages, fostering quick and efficient communication.
The Message Composer component includes an ActionSheet. This ActionSheet serves as a menu appearing over the app’s context, offering various options for sharing media files.
CometChat’s Read Receipts feature provides visibility into the message status, letting users know when a message has been delivered and read. This brings clarity to the communication and ensures users are informed about the status of their messages.
Conversations is a component that renders conversation list item. Conversation item also displays the delivery status of the last message providing users with real-time updates on the status of their messages.
Message List is a component that renders different types of message bubbles. Read receipt status is an integral part of all message bubbles, no matter the type and provides real-time updates about the status of the message.
Message Information
Message Information component provides transparency into the status of each sent message, giving the sender insights into whether their message has been delivered and read.
Mark as Unread feature allows users to manually mark messages as unread, helping them keep track of important conversations they want to revisit later. When enabled, the message list can automatically start from the first unread message, making it easier to pick up where you left off.
The Typing Indicator feature in CometChat shows when a user is typing a response in real-time, fostering a more interactive and engaging chat environment. This feature enhances the real-time communication experience, making conversations feel more natural and fluid.
Conversations is a component that renders conversation list item. Conversations item also shows real-time typing status indicators. This means that if a user in a one-on-one chat or a participant in a group chat is currently typing a message.
Message Header that renders details of User or Groups in ToolBar. The Message Header also handles the typing indicator functionality. When a user or a member in a group is typing, the Message Header dynamically updates to display a typing... status in real-time.
CometChat’s User Presence feature allows users to see whether their contacts are online, offline. This helps users know the best time to initiate a conversation and sets expectations about response times.
CometChat’s Reactions feature adds a layer of expressiveness to your chat application by allowing users to react to messages. With reactions, users can convey a range of emotions or express their thoughts on a particular message without typing out a full response, enhancing their user experience and fostering greater engagement.
Message List is a component that renders different types of message bubbles. Reactions are an integral part and offer a more engaging, expressive way for users to respond to messages.
Mentions is a robust feature provided by CometChat that enhances the interactivity and clarity of group or 1-1 chats by allowing users to directly address or refer to specific individuals in a conversation. The feature also supports group mentions like @all, enabling users to quickly notify all members in a group chat simultaneously.
Conversations component provides an enhanced user experience by integrating the Mentions feature. This means that from the conversation list itself, users can see where they or someone else have been specifically mentioned.
Message Composer is a component that allows users to craft and send various types of messages, including the usage of the mentions feature for direct addressing within the conversation.
Message List is a component that displays a list of sent and received messages. It also supports the rendering of Mentions, enhancing the readability and interactivity of conversations.
Rich Text Formatting allows users to style their messages with bold, italic, underline, strikethrough, code, links, lists, and blockquotes. This brings richer expression to conversations and helps users emphasize key points, making communication clearer and more engaging.
CompactMessageComposer provides a built-in rich text editor with formatting toolbar, floating selection toolbar, and keyboard shortcuts for bold, italic, underline, strikethrough, code, links, lists, and blockquotes.
MessageList renders formatted messages with the appropriate styling applied, displaying bold, italic, underline, strikethrough, code, links, lists, and blockquote formatting as intended by the sender.
The Threaded Conversations feature enables users to respond directly to a specific message in a chat. This keeps conversations organized and enhances the user experience by maintaining context, especially in group chats.
Quoted Replies is a robust feature provided by CometChat that enables users to quickly reply to specific messages by selecting the “Reply” option from a message’s action menu. This enhances context, keeps conversations organized, and improves overall chat experience in both 1-1 and group chats.
Message List supports replying to messages via the “Reply” option. Users can select “Reply” on a message to open the composer with the quoted reply pre-filled, maintaining context.
CometChat facilitates Group Chats, allowing users to have conversations with multiple participants simultaneously. This feature is crucial for team collaborations, group discussions, social communities, and more.
CometChat’s Message Moderation feature helps maintain a safe and respectful chat environment by automatically filtering and managing inappropriate content. Messages can be automatically blocked or flagged based on predefined rules, ensuring harmful content is handled before it reaches users.

The Report Message feature allows users to report inappropriate or harmful messages within the chat. Users can choose from predefined reasons and provide additional remarks for detailed context. This feature helps maintain a safe and respectful chat environment.

Message List provides the “Report Message” option in the message actions menu, allowing users to initiate the reporting process for inappropriate messages.
Conversation and Advanced Search is a powerful feature provided by CometChat that enables users to quickly find conversations, messages, and media across chats in real time. It supports filters, scopes, and custom actions, allowing users to locate content efficiently while keeping the chat experience smooth and intuitive.
Search allows users to search across conversations and messages in real time. Users can click on a result to open the conversation or jump directly to a specific message.
